Roger Stone analyzes a series of controversial leadership appointments and legislative battles under the Trump administration. Stone defends the selection of Bill Pulte as Director of National Intelligence, framing him as a necessary outsider capable of challenging the entrenched "deep state" and investigating past election integrity. The program expands into a broader defense of populist-conservative movements, highlighting a significant rightward shift in Latin American politics and celebrating domestic gains in border security and job growth.
